Handover: Stackwell garage occupancy feed. Poller hits the gate controllers every 30s; stale readings are dropped after three misses. Deploy order matters — feed service before the dashboard, or counts flatline. Rollback is safe; schema unchanged since v2.3. Alert thresholds are in the ops config, don't touch mid-release. Any release-blocking issue on this feed goes straight to the owner named below.

named custodian: Brivan Eliath Quenox Frador

Quarterly Planning Note — Fernwick Pilot Churn

For the incoming director: churn in the Fernwick pilot reached 14% this quarter, concentrated in month-two cancellations. Exit interviews point to onboarding friction, not pricing. We have scoped a revised activation flow for Q2 and paused expansion to Marlowe Bay. The confidential note below sets out how this affects the wider plan.

board note of bawep-tajef: Queniusek Systems plans to raise the Quenvan list price by 53.1 percent in March. The pricing group signed off on a budget of $176.4 million for Project Drueth. The renewal with Casionix Partners closes at $142.5 million a year, 8.3 percent below the last contract. Project Fraax slips by six weeks because of the tooling delay.

**TICKET BR-412: Plugin sandbox env misconfigured after hermetic migration**

Since Lanterbeck moved the Quillfort build to the new hermetic toolchain, plugin authors can no longer rely on host-installed SDKs. All inputs must be declared in your manifest. Your sandbox env file also needs the registry credential; add the following line directly below this ticket note.

vault entry, yahif-yajep: COURIER_KEY29=b802bdf8034096b65a51c6ba5abe2